<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://www.sitemaps.org/schemas/sitemap/0.9 http://www.sitemaps.org/schemas/sitemap/0.9/sitemap.xsd" x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
  <url>
    <loc>http://perfectionkills.com/</loc>
    <lastmod>2025-10-09T04:52:31+00:00</lastmod>
    <changefreq>daily</changefreq>
    <priority>1.0</priority>
  </url>
  
  
  
  
  <url>
    <loc>http://perfectionkills.com/my-fitness-from-spreadsheet-to-an-app/</loc>
    <lastmod>2025-10-04T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/przilla-crossfit-ai-companion/</loc>
    <lastmod>2025-09-10T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/using-ai-to-accurately-predict-crossfit/</loc>
    <lastmod>2025-05-31T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/javascript-quiz-es6/</loc>
    <lastmod>2015-11-04T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/the-poor-misunderstood-innerText/</loc>
    <lastmod>2015-04-01T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/know-thy-reference/</loc>
    <lastmod>2014-12-11T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/refactoring-single-page-app/</loc>
    <lastmod>2014-09-01T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/html-minifier-revisited/</loc>
    <lastmod>2014-07-28T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/jscritic/</loc>
    <lastmod>2014-03-27T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/state-of-function-decompilation-in-javascript/</loc>
    <lastmod>2014-01-14T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/moving-from-wordpress-to-github-pages/</loc>
    <lastmod>2014-01-13T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/exploring-canvas-drawing-techniques/</loc>
    <lastmod>2013-12-03T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/becoming-a-superhero/</loc>
    <lastmod>2013-10-24T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/profiling-css-for-fun-and-profit-optimization-notes/</loc>
    <lastmod>2012-01-04T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/fabric-js-0-5-is-out/</loc>
    <lastmod>2011-08-22T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/extending-native-builtins/</loc>
    <lastmod>2011-08-08T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/refactoring-javascript-with-kratko-js/</loc>
    <lastmod>2011-06-13T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/unnecessarily-comprehensive-look-into-a-rather-insignificant-issue-of-global-objects-creation/</loc>
    <lastmod>2011-03-01T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/a-closer-look-at-expression-closures/</loc>
    <lastmod>2011-01-17T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/global-eval-what-are-the-options/</loc>
    <lastmod>2010-12-15T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/how-ecmascript-5-still-does-not-allow-to-subclass-an-array/</loc>
    <lastmod>2010-07-15T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/jscript-and-dom-changes-in-ie9-preview-3/</loc>
    <lastmod>2010-06-24T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/tag-is-not-an-element-or-is-it/</loc>
    <lastmod>2010-06-01T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/whats-wrong-with-extending-the-dom/</loc>
    <lastmod>2010-04-05T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/experimenting-with-html-minifier/</loc>
    <lastmod>2010-03-09T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/javascript-quiz/</loc>
    <lastmod>2010-02-08T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/understanding-delete/</loc>
    <lastmod>2010-01-10T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/optimizing-html/</loc>
    <lastmod>2009-12-29T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/moved-to-perfectionkills-com/</loc>
    <lastmod>2009-12-17T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/onloadfunction-considered-harmful/</loc>
    <lastmod>2009-12-09T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/foxify-bookmarklet/</loc>
    <lastmod>2009-12-01T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/sputniktests-web-runner/</loc>
    <lastmod>2009-11-09T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/professional-javascript-review/</loc>
    <lastmod>2009-10-28T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/whitespace-deviations/</loc>
    <lastmod>2009-08-23T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/detecting-global-variable-leaks</loc>
    <lastmod>2009-08-08T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/safarify-bookmarklet</loc>
    <lastmod>2009-07-19T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/named-function-expressions-demystified</loc>
    <lastmod>2009-06-15T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/those-tricky-functions</loc>
    <lastmod>2009-06-01T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/feature-testing-css-properties</loc>
    <lastmod>2009-05-11T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/detecting-event-support-without-browser-sniffing</loc>
    <lastmod>2009-04-01T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/domlint-resolving-name-conflicts</loc>
    <lastmod>2009-03-09T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/event-delegation-will-save-the-world</loc>
    <lastmod>2009-02-19T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/detecting-built-in-host-methods</loc>
    <lastmod>2009-02-07T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/misbehaving-ie8</loc>
    <lastmod>2009-01-29T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/instanceof-considered-harmful-or-how-to-write-a-robust-isarray/</loc>
    <lastmod>2009-01-10T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/feature-detection-all-the-way</loc>
    <lastmod>2008-12-09T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/semantic-constructors</loc>
    <lastmod>2008-07-16T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/protolicious</loc>
    <lastmod>2008-05-27T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/updated-scripteka</loc>
    <lastmod>2008-04-29T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/namespacing-made-easy</loc>
    <lastmod>2008-01-30T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/prototype-1602-cheat-sheet</loc>
    <lastmod>2008-01-22T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/protoips-in-place-select-widget</loc>
    <lastmod>2007-12-22T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/protomenu-gets-facelift</loc>
    <lastmod>2007-12-03T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/cross-browser-mouse-events-simulation</loc>
    <lastmod>2007-11-07T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/its-coming</loc>
    <lastmod>2007-11-04T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/detect-idle-state-with-custom-events</loc>
    <lastmod>2007-10-17T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/refactoring-with-prototype</loc>
    <lastmod>2007-10-05T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/so-you-want-more-documentation</loc>
    <lastmod>2007-09-24T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/wrap-it-up</loc>
    <lastmod>2007-09-14T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/protolazy-do-we-really-need-lazy-image-loading</loc>
    <lastmod>2007-09-11T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/with-or-without</loc>
    <lastmod>2007-09-06T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/common-mistakes-and-how-to-avoid-them</loc>
    <lastmod>2007-09-03T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/extending-the-limits</loc>
    <lastmod>2007-08-28T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/we-dont-need-no-stinkin-new</loc>
    <lastmod>2007-08-21T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/meet-protomenu-simple-context-menu-class</loc>
    <lastmod>2007-08-20T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
  <url>
    <loc>http://perfectionkills.com/how-well-do-you-know-prototype-part-ii</loc>
    <lastmod>2007-08-12T00:00:00+00:00</lastmod>
    <changefreq>weekly</changefreq>
    <priority>0.8</priority>
  </url>
  
</urlset>

